The Israel national football team, governed by the Israel Football Association (founded 1928), has had a unique footballing journey, competing in both Asian and European zones before settling in UEFA in 1994. The team famously qualified for the 1970 FIFA World Cup in Mexico, their only World Cup appearance to date, reaching the group stage. They have competed regularly in UEFA European Championship qualifiers and the UEFA Nations League. Notable players include Eran Zahavi, Yossi Benayoun, and Ronny Rosenthal, who also had distinguished club careers abroad. The team has produced a generation of players competing at high levels in Europe. Based in Israel, they have shown improving performances in recent UEFA Nations League campaigns, demonstrating the growing strength of domestic football.
